Fat Pimp is a pioneer of music from Dallas, Texas. With over 10

plus years in the music industry, He is a Billboard

recording artist who broke through as an underground rapper with his very first release. “Fat Pimp”, given his moniker by a

high school classmate, began developing his love for music first as a producer, but gradually became known for his impromptu

free style sessions while attending Texas Southern University in Houston, Texas.

He was able to attend concerts at an early age and grew up in the church choir he also played in his middle school band. In High

School, he signed up for classes in the media technical department to learn how to record and mix vocals for television and

music. He was able to hone in on his skills as a producer to conceive his first hit “Rack Daddy”, this breakout single spread like a

virus on the internet and throughout the southern regions. He was signed to Warner Brothers (2008). As a producer and artist he

has been cranking out hits since he started, landing him with multiple singles to hit the Billboard charts including the club banger

“Maserati”. He also had time to Co-Star in the hit movie “Triple D” (2014).

While releasing tracks with the likes of Waka Flocka and Manny Fresh, Fat Pimp, has been dominating the Southern Hip Hop

scene for the last 10 years and has no intentions of slowing down. He always tries to find a positive space and a studio with fresh

and peaceful energy. Fat Pimp said, “that the key to making timeless music is good smoke and positive thinking”...

Currently, he is co –hosting The New Podcast “Get N Tha Game” with Kiki J. His latest records “Uh Oh” and “Hurt They Feelings”

hit the scene this last year in preparation for his next mix tape titled ‘Life After Rack Daddy 1st Quarter”. Fat Pimp is Ready to

Start a New Chapter in Life with his soon to be released album “Long Way From Camp Wisdom” which will be his next album to

drop this fall 2017.
